  "account": "Kedah PAS Youth leader Ilyas Ahmad has declared that the party will continue to champion Islam in its political struggle to preserve the religion in Malaysia. Addressing his party's 67th muktamar, Ahmad criticized those who have accused his party of exploiting religion for political gain. \"Several DAP and Amanah leaders are becoming increasingly bold in belittling us,\" he stated.\n\nAhmad highlighted recent court rulings and university events as evidence that Islam and Muslim values are being sidelined. He cited the Federal Court's decision in August to reject Kedah's attempt to overturn a ban on pool betting and lottery operators, as well as the 2024 ruling that struck down 16 provisions of Kelantan's syariah criminal enactment, as proof of weakening Islamic law under the current unity government.\n\nThe PAS Youth chief also criticized unchecked erosion of Muslim values on campuses, citing a music festival at UKM and other events at UM that he believed were damaging the faith and morals of young Malaysians. \"All of these show that Islam, which should be placed on a high pedestal, is instead increasingly being pushed into an undignified position,\" he said.\n\nAhmad emphasized the need for unity between PAS and Umno to remove the current government from power in the next general election, asserting that the coalition's record on Islam and Malay rights has been a failure. He emphasized that the Muslim community must champion the religion if others do not, asking DAP and Amanah leaders what else they should champion.",
